Chloroquinoxaline sulfonamide (Legacy Tebubio ref. 282T14953). Chloroquinoxaline sulfonamide (Chloroquinoxaline) is a topoisomerase II alpha/beta toxin with antitumor activity and immunosuppressive properties that inhibits the proliferation of B16 melanoma cells in mice, and can be used to study metastatic colorectal cancer. Choerospondin (Legacy Tebubio ref. 282T14957). Choerospondin, a dietary flavonoid glycoside isolated from the bark of the southern date palm (Ziziphus jujuba L.), is a potential α-glucosidase inhibitor with antiproliferative, antioxidant, antitumor, and anti-inflammatory activities that enhances the resistance to oxidative stress, and significantly inhibits inflammatory responses by attenuating mitogen-activated protein kinase phosphorylation and nuclear factor-κ B activation.

Amiodarone hydrochloride (Legacy Tebubio ref. 282T1496). Amiodarone hydrochloride (Amiodarone HCl) is an antianginal and class III antiarrhythmic drug. It increases the duration of ventricular and atrial muscle action by inhibiting POTASSIUM CHANNELS and VOLTAGE-GATED SODIUM CHANNELS. There is a resulting decrease in heart rate and in vascular resistance.
